Read moreWhat does memory tweak do?
–memory-tweak or -mt allows you to select the memory timings values from 1 to 6 . Where 1 is the lowest timings intensity and 6 is the highest. Be careful when using higher values, as higher values could cause rejects or crashes.

Read moreHow do I enable my GPU for mining?
Open Radeon settings by double clicking the red Radeon logo (Windows main screen lower right corner) Go to “Gaming” -> “Global Settings” Choose your GPU for mining. Switch “GPU Workload” from ”Graphics” to “Compute” and confirm by “Yes”.
